The neck is a region with complex anatomy, housing numerous small and closely spaced anatomical structures. Accurate diagnosis of neck lesions requires a thorough understanding of normal spatial relations and anatomical variations. Computed Tomography (CT) imaging offers enhanced visualization, providing crucial information for better patient management.1 The suprahyoid and infrahyoid portions of the neck are separated at the level of the hyoid bone.
